BREAKING: George Floyd’s death: CNN crew arrested live on TV in Minneapolis

A reporter of Cable News Network (CNN), Omar Jimenez has been arrested live on air while reporting on the scene of the ongoing protests in Minneapolis.
Also arrested are the camera crew and Omar’s producer. The reason for the arrest is yet to be known.
However, before the arrest, police could be overheard asking Mr Jimenez and his television crew to step backwards.
Footages of the arrest quickly surfaced online.
Jimenez’s colleagues also took to twitter to express outrage over the incident.
They have been very chaotic protest in Minneapolis since a black man named George Floyd was killed by a white police officer who knelt on his neck. Although the officer has been sacked, charges are yet to be filed against him.
